一、为什么需要使用map? 为什么需要使用map?前面源码分析中常见它的身影,在里面充当了一个什么作用? Map存储的元素为键值对,通常称为key-value 而key是不允许重复的 Set存储对象唯一 二、掌握Map的常用方法 三...
map
map中插入元素的方法有如下集中 1.1 直接用[]符 map<int, string> mymap; mymap[1] = "a"; map的源码中重载了[]操作符, map<_Key, _Tp, _Compare, _Allocator>::operator[](key_type&& __k) {...
1 简介 unordered_map是一个将key和value关联起来的容器,它可以高效的根据单个key值...unordered_map查询单个key的时候效率比map高,但是要查询某一范围内的key值时比map效率低。 可以使用[]操作符来访问key值对应的
本文找先不涉及两种数据结构的底层,目标是:理解Map和Set的大体框架,了解他们有什么用,用在哪里的然后再从浅层深入底层。小编认为:先了解也下Map和Set大体是用来做什么,如何用,用在那,是首先应该学的。对底层...
set的文档set直接翻译成中文是集合,而他与数学意义上的集合也有不同的地方,set是要求有序的,其次set中的元素不能被修改,元素是const的,但是允许插入删除set的有序是可以自行定义升序或者降序的,默认是按照小于...
map的介绍,声明,使用方式,crud操作以及遍历,map原理详解
map和multimap。
map简介 map是STL的一个关联容器,以键值对存储的数据,其类型可以自己定义,每个关键字在map中只能出现一次,关键字不能修改,值可以修改;map同set、multiset、multimap(与map的差别仅在于multimap允许一个键...
对于面试,一定要有良好的心态,这位小伙伴面试美团的时候没有被前面阿里的面试影响到,发挥也很正常,也就能顺利拿下美团的offer。小编还整理了大厂java程序员面试涉及到的绝大部分面试题及答案,希望能帮助到大家...
Go语言map的概念以及使用、sync.map的使用
Java基础知识之Map的使用
大家好啊,我是汤圆,今天给大家带来的是《Java中的映射Map - 入门篇》,希望对大家有帮助,谢谢 简介 前面介绍了集合List,这里开始简单介绍下映射Map,相关类如下图所示 正文 Map是一种存储键值对的数据集合,键...
需要引入的头文件不同 map: #include &lt; map &gt; unordered_map: #include &lt; unordered_map &...map: map内部实现了一个红黑树(红黑树是非严格平衡二叉搜索树,而AVL是严格平衡二...
vuemap/vue-amap是一套基于Vue3 和高德地图2.0的地图组件。 该版本对原vue-amap组件进行升级,主要适配amap2.0相关的接口,同时调整事件绑定形式,调整为使用v-on进行事件绑定。 组件中将会对高德可视化组件loca进行...
map遍历集合
学Map集合,这一篇不看我替你遗憾
1 map()函数的简介以及语法: map是python内置函数,会根据提供的函数对指定的序列做映射。 map()函数的格式是: map(function,iterable,...) 第一个参数接受一个函数名,后面的参数接受一个或多个可迭代的...
Vue和高德地图2.0的地图组件vue-amap-dev.zip
本文将介绍sourcemap的作用和原理,以及它在调试和部署中的应用。sourcemap是一种重要的调试和部署工具,可以帮助开发者提高调试效率和代码的可维护性。了解sourcemap的作用和原理对于开发者来说具有重要意义。掌握...
本文详细介绍map的各种用法和注意事项。
C++中`map`和`unordered_map`提供的是一种键值对容器,在实际开发中会经常用到,它跟Python的字典很类似,所有的数据都是成对出现的,每一对中的第一个值称之为关键字(key),每个关键字只能在map中出现一次;...
/4//如果key不存在,但是有ifAbsent参数,返回idAbsent函数的值,并添加到map中print(‘resultMap101//10,int});return 7;//如果没有这行,b11对应的value为null 这里可以看出updateall会影响所有的键值对});//{b12:...
OpenLayers 是一个开源的 JavaScript 库,用于在网页中构建交互式的地图应用程序。ol/Map 类是 OpenLayers API 中的核心组件之一,它负责创建和管理整个地图实例。**
map常用操作详细讲解
STL:unordered_map使用笔记 参考网址: cpluscplus unordered_map与map的区别(CSDN) 1.概述 unordered_map的模板定义如下: template < class Key, // unordered_map::key_type class T, // unordered_map: